Don't Wordle Rules
Basic Objective
- The puzzle picks one hidden five-letter answer.
- You must keep every guess legal under the clues you have already revealed.
- If you ever submit the hidden answer, you immediately Wordle and lose.
- If you fill all six rows without submitting the answer, you survive.
Color Rules
Green
That exact letter must stay in that exact slot from then on.
Yellow
That letter must keep appearing, but not in the same slot where it just failed.
Gray
The letter is eliminated entirely if it never appears in the answer, or it tells you that you have already used as many copies of that letter as the answer allows.
What Makes a Guess Legal
- All green letters must stay fixed.
- All discovered yellow and green letters must keep appearing enough times.
- Letters that have been fully eliminated cannot be reused.
- Letter-position combinations that already failed cannot be repeated.
- If duplicate-letter clues reveal a maximum count, you cannot exceed it.
Valid Words Remaining
The counter at the top shows how many legal guesses are still available. It is not a count of possible answers. It measures how many words you are still allowed to type. When the counter falls faster than the number of possible answers, the board is closing in on you.
Undo and Elimination
- Standard mode gives you five Undos.
- Hard Mode gives you two Undos.
- If legal guesses remaining are too few for the rows you still need, you are eliminated.
- If you still have Undo available, that state is temporary and Undo is your only way out.
- If you have no Undo left, the elimination becomes final.
